Given data:
The number of oscillations of the particle in 2 seconds is 50.
Solution:
The frequency is defined as the number of oscillations of the particle in one second.
Thus, the frequency of the oscillation of particle is,
[tex]f=\frac{n}{t}[/tex]where n is the number of oscillations, and t is the time,
Substituting the known values,
[tex]\begin{gathered} f=\frac{50}{2} \\ f=25\text{ Hz} \end{gathered}[/tex]Thus, the frequency of oscillation is 25 hertz.
